Doesn’t a pre-tribulation rapture go against scripture because Mat 24:21 is before Mat 24:31.

Matthew 24:21 “For then shall be great tribulation, such as was not since the beginning of the world to this time, no, nor ever shall be.”

Matthew 24:31 “And he shall send his angels with a great sound of a trumpet, and they shall gather together his elect from the four winds [corners], from one end of heaven to the other.”
